享未来数码网
首页 > 彩电 > 揭秘嵌入式开发从概念到实践的全方位解析

揭秘嵌入式开发从概念到实践的全方位解析

揭秘嵌入式开发:从概念到实践的全方位解析

嵌入式系统的定义与特点

嵌入式系统是指将计算机技术用于控制和管理各种设备、机械或电子产品中的一种技术。它们通常具有自主运行的能力,能够在不需要用户干预的情况下进行数据处理和控制。在现代社会,这些系统无处不在,从智能手机到家用电器,再到汽车、医疗设备等领域都有其应用。

嵌入式开发语言及其选择标准

嵌入式开发使用的编程语言多样,包括C、C++、Java等。这些语言因其效率、高性能以及可移植性而广泛应用于嵌入式环境。选择合适的编程语言时,主要考虑的是程序执行速度、内存需求以及对硬件资源的兼容性。

嵌入式软件设计原则

设计嵌实软件时需遵循一定原则,如模块化和分层结构,以便于维护和升级。此外,还要考虑异常处理机制,以及如何确保代码质量及安全性。在实际项目中,还需结合硬件平台特点进行优化,以达到最佳性能。

嵌入式操作系统与框架

不同类型的设备可能需要不同的操作系统来支撑其功能,如RTOS(实时操作系统)、Linux甚至Android等。同时,由于资源限制,一些专门为小型微控制器设计的小型操作系统也被广泛应用。这些操作系统提供了基础支持,使得上层应用程序可以更加专注于业务逻辑实现。

嵌入式测试方法论与工具

为了确保嵌入式产品满足性能要求,必须采用有效测试策略。这通常涉及单元测试、集成测试乃至最终用户验收测试。此外,有许多专业工具可供选用,比如仿真器用于模拟硬件环境,以及自动化脚本帮助提高测试效率。

未来的发展趋势与挑战

随着物联网(IoT)技术快速发展,未来嵓密套会更加依赖网络通信和大数据分析能力。而这也带来了新的挑战,比如安全性问题如何得到有效解决,以及面对不断变化的人口需求如何保持创新动力。不过,无疑,这也是一个充满活力的行业,为工程师们提供了巨大的职业发展空间。

标签:

猜你喜欢

苏宁电器 在小户型中如何...
当我们谈论客厅电视墙装修设计时,我们往往关注的是整体的美观与实用性。然而,在小户型中,空间有限,这一考量变得尤为重要。要在狭小的空间内打造一个既有功能又富...
复读机 如何在只有4平...
在现代生活中,住宅面积的缩小成为了一个普遍现象。尤其是在大都市,房价高昂,居住空间日益紧张。因此,对于那些仅有4平米的小卧室来说,如何装修和布置以达到舒适...
三星彩电la46n71bx xtt 绿色家居的选择...
绿色家居的选择:探索复合木地板的魅力与实用性 在现代家居装修中,环保材料的需求日益增长。其中,复合木地板因其独特的优点而受到越来越多消费者的青睐。这不仅仅...
摄影技术 水电定额清单报...
精确计算每一滴的价值:行业标准与企业实践 在建筑工程中,水电定额清单报价是一个不可或缺的环节,它涉及到对各种水电设施的详细计量和成本评估。一个高效、准确的...

强力推荐